I finally got my Service Invoice sent to me from the dealer (for some reason they couldn't print it out when I picked up the car because the Service Manager was on vacation...????). Anyway, they did not replace our battery. Recharged it, reprogrammed the batter energy control module, the brake system control module, the serial data gateway module....

Not sure if all those reprogrammed modules were related to the 12v battery draining, and I'm less than pleased that they just recharged a battery that had gone flat dead. We shall see
